SHOW NOTES: Intro Shoutout to Seth making memes in FB Group Podchaser Reviews4Good Background (03:55) Kamala Khan created by Sana Amanat, Stephen Wacker, G. Willow Wilson, Adrian Alphona, and Jamie McKelvie in Captain Marvel #14 (August 2013) in a one-panel cameo, but first major appearance was Ms. Marvel #1 (Feb. 2014) First generation Pakistani-American, she chafes against the rules of her parents - she’s a major superhero fangirl, and writes fanfiction about the Avengers, especially Carol Danvers, whom she idolizes One night she sneaks out of the house only to end up exposed to the Terrigen Mists, which unlock her latent Inhuman genes – she has the power to shape-shift Her friend Bruno learns of her abilities after she gets shot stopping Bruno’s brother from robbing a store, and becomes her “man in the chair” - he helps her defeat the Inventor, a hybrid of Thomas Edison & a cockatiel In Secret Wars, she helps Carol protect Jersey City, and gets her family & friends to a safe place while they wait for the world to end - once the Incursions pass and the realities merge, she continues operating as Ms. Marvel During a battle against Warbringer, she’s joined by Nova, Spider-Man, and several Avengers - Iron Man offers her a spot on the team, and she accepts Deals with HYDRA using her likeness to co-opt their redevelopment scheme which involves brainwashing residents - manages to defeat them, but takes hit to her reputation During Civil War II arc, initially sides with Carol Danvers, but comes to realize Carol’s manipulating her and stands up to her idol, especially after Carol’s precog arrests a friend of hers who was supposedly going to blow up the school - in the ensuing attempt to rescue Josh, Bruno is seriously injured, and he blames Kamala She quits the Avengers, because they’re too globally focused - she joins the Champions with other young heroes instead She reconciles with Carol, as well as Bruno - they begin dating in the newest series, where it’s revealed that all of her friends and her parents all know of her dual identity Issues (11:12) Initially coping with strict parents – common teenage issue Fangirling of heroes leads to broken pedestal, especially with Carol Danvers (20:23) Unrequited crush on Bruno leads to heartache (28:32) Break Plugs for Talk Me Into, We’re All Mad Here, and Saladin Ahmed Treatment (38:20) In-universe - Interpersonal therapy, focus on the details for a change Out of universe (43:23) - Skit (Kamala voiced by Nur Chodry, who won the open casting call!) Productora de cuatro de las diez películas mas taquilleras en la historia del cine a nivel mundial. Victoria se unió a Marvel como vicepresidenta ejecutiva de efectos visuales y postproducción y también ha fungido como productora ejecutiva de todas las películas del llamado MCU, Marvel Cinematic Universe. Entre ellas están Iron Man, Thor, Captain America, Avengers, Ant-Man, Guardianes de la Galaxia, Doctor Strange, Spider-Man: Homecoming, Black Panther, y la más reciente, Captain Marvel. Story: Es ist einige Zeit vergangen, seit die Avengers New York gegen den Angriff einer außerirdischen Armee verteidigt haben. Jeder ist seitdem seinen eigenen Weg gegangen und manch einer hatte sein ganz persönliches Abenteuer zu bestehen. Als Milliardär Tony Stark ein stillgelegtes Friedensprogramm reaktiviert, gerät die Situation plötzlich außer Kontrolle und das Schicksal der Erde steht auf dem Spiel. Gemeinsam müssen sich die Avengers Iron Man, Thor, Hulk, Captain America, Black Widow und Hawkeye gegen den scheinbar übermächtigen Ultron stellen, der wild entschlossen ist, die gesamte Menschheit auszulöschen. Um seine Pläne zu vereiteln, müssen die Avengers unberechenbare Allianzen eingehen und in eine Schlacht von globalen Ausmaßen ziehen. — Kann SPOILER enthalten! Bundesstart: 23.04.2015 (Walt Disney Studios Motion Pictures Germany) Action, Abenteuer, Science-Fiction, Fantasy Land: USA 2015 Laufzeit: ca. 141 min.
